Dominik Szoboszlai, a midfielder for Liverpool, has been declared by Paul Merson to be his new favourite Premier League player.
Szoboszlai arrived at Anfield this summer and immediately made an impact. The 23-year-old, who arrived from RB Leipzig, gives the appearance of having played for Liverpool his entire life.
Merson takes this into account in his Premier League picks for Sportskeeda this week. The commentator believes the Reds will defeat Luton Town 3-0 on Sunday and singles out Szoboszlai for special attention.
On the flip side, I think that Dominik Szoboszlai has been the best player in the Premier League this year; he’s been fantastic! exclaimed the former midfielder for England.
“He’s come into a brand new league for a huge fee and settled in quicker than snow, that is some achievement.”
